The I.D. case from CameMate is an interesting case that allows you to keep your I.D. or credit cards in the back. Personally, I think this would be a great case for people who go to bars a lot, just so they don't have to remember much. The case is very slim and doesn't add too much bulk to your phone. If you use your debit cards or your I.D. a lot, and you have an iPhone 4, this is the case for you.
